From Research Origins to Global Lab Equipment Manufacturing
Inovenso was founded in 2007 out of academic research in nanotechnology and precision fluid control. What began as a research-driven venture has grown into a globally recognized manufacturer of laboratory and industrial pump systems, with devices used across universities, pharmaceutical companies, biotech firms, and industrial facilities in more than 65 countries.
As international demand expanded, Inovenso strengthened its global presence through its Boston, MA, USA operations — close to one of the world’s leading biotechnology and research ecosystems. From this base, the team developed the IPS Syringe Pump Series and the IPS-20 Peristaltic Pump System, both built on the principle that precision instruments should be accurate, durable, and simple to operate.
Today, more than 600 IPS pump systems are in active use across research institutions, pharmaceutical companies, and industrial facilities in over 65 countries. The IPS Series has been cited in peer-reviewed publications in fields including electrospinning, microfluidics, mass spectrometry, and drug delivery research. How We Got Here
Key moments in Inovenso's journey from university spin-off to global precision instrument manufacturer.
Inovenso was established with a focus on nanotechnology research tools and precision fluid control systems for academic and industrial laboratories. The founding team combined deep engineering expertise with direct experience in laboratory research workflows.
The IPS Series debuted with a focus on accuracy, reliability, and intuitive operation. Built on Microstep Drive stepper motor technology, the platform delivered 357 nm/µstep resolution and a flow range from 17.89 pL/min to 121.51 mL/min — capabilities previously unavailable at this price point.
To better serve the growing North American and global research market, Inovenso strengthened its operations in Boston, MA, USA — establishing closer access to one of the world’s leading ecosystems for research universities, biotech companies, and pharmaceutical institutions.
IPS pump systems are in active use at hundreds of research institutions, pharmaceutical companies, and industrial facilities worldwide. The product line spans syringe pump series and peristaltic pump systems, covering precise low-flow research applications and larger-volume continuous fluid transfer workflows.
